XPhyto Therapeutics Receives German Cannabis Licence for Scientific Cultivation and Extraction

July 24, 2019 6:00 AM EDT | Source: BioNxt Solutions Inc.

Vancouver, British Columbia--(Newsfile Corp. - July 24, 2019) - XPhyto Therapeutics Corp. ("XPhyto" or the "Company") is pleased to announce that the German Federal Institute for Drugs and Medical Devices ("BfArM") has granted XPhyto's wholly owned German subsidiary, Bunker Pflanzenextrakte GmbH ("Bunker"), a cannabis cultivation and extraction licence for scientific purposes (the "Licence"). Subject to meeting BfArM security requirements, the Licence is valid and authorizes the Company to cultivate and extract up to 70 different strains of Cannabis sativa and indica for scientific purposes at Bunker's high-security facility located in a monitored security area in the south of Germany (Bavaria).

About XPhyto Therapeutics Corp.

XPhyto is a science-focused cannabis company developing analytical testing, processing, and formulation capability in Canada and research, cultivation, extraction, import, distribution, and manufacturing in Germany. Two exclusive 5-year engagements with the Faculty of Pharmacy at a major Canadian university provide certified analytical testing capability, as well as extraction, isolation, and formulation facilities, and drug research and development expertise. XPhyto acquired 100% ownership of the German cannabis company Bunker Pflanzenextrakte GmbH, which has been granted a cannabis cultivation and extraction licence for scientific purposes by BfArM, the German Federal Institute for Drugs and Medical Devices.
